Why Local News Matters
Local news is the heartbeat of any community. It's way more than just headlines; it's the stuff that directly impacts your day-to-day life. Think about it – national and international news is important, sure, but does it tell you about the road closures on your commute or the new restaurant opening downtown? Probably not!
Local news keeps you informed about:
- Community Events: From farmers' markets to town hall meetings, local news outlets keep you in the loop about what's happening around you.
- School Board Decisions: Changes to school policies, budget allocations, and important dates all fall under the local news umbrella, directly affecting families in the area.
- Local Economy: New businesses, job opportunities, and economic trends specific to your region are vital for understanding the health of your community.
- Public Safety: Crime reports, emergency alerts, and safety advisories help you stay aware of potential risks and keep your family safe.
- Local Politics: Knowing who your representatives are and what they're working on helps you participate in local government and make informed decisions.
Staying connected to local news sources ensures you're not just living in your community, but actively participating in it. It's about being an informed and engaged citizen, and that starts with knowing what's happening right outside your door.

The BBC and Local News: What to Expect
Now, let's talk about the BBC. When you think of the BBC, you might immediately picture international news and British programming. However, the BBC also has a significant presence in local news coverage within the United Kingdom.
Here's how the BBC contributes to local news:
- BBC Local Radio: The BBC operates a network of local radio stations throughout the UK, each serving a specific region. These stations provide news, traffic updates, weather forecasts, and community information tailored to their local audience. You can usually find these stations online through the BBC Sounds app or the BBC website.
- BBC Local News Websites: The BBC has local news websites for different regions of the UK. These websites offer a mix of breaking news, feature stories, and community information. They often include video and audio content from BBC Local Radio and TV.
- BBC Regional TV: The BBC has regional television channels that broadcast local news programs and current affairs shows. These programs cover issues and events specific to the region, providing in-depth analysis and reporting. These channels also report national UK news.
It's important to note that the BBC's local news coverage is primarily focused on the UK. If you're looking for local news in another country, you'll need to rely on local news outlets and resources specific to that area.

The Future of Local News
The way we consume local news is constantly evolving. With the rise of digital media and social media, local news outlets are adapting to new platforms and technologies to reach their audiences. Here are some trends to watch for in the future of local news:
- Hyperlocal News: Expect to see more news outlets focusing on very specific geographic areas or communities. This hyperlocal approach allows for more targeted and relevant coverage of local issues.
- Data Journalism: Local news outlets are increasingly using data analysis and visualization to tell stories and uncover trends. This can lead to more in-depth and insightful reporting on local issues.
- Community-Driven Journalism: Some news outlets are experimenting with community-driven journalism models, where local residents contribute stories, photos, and videos. This can help to diversify the voices and perspectives represented in the news.
- Mobile-First Approach: As more people access news on their smartphones and tablets, local news outlets are prioritizing mobile-friendly websites and apps. This ensures that readers can easily access the news on the go.
